The Written Report:

-Paper must be typed in Word and be between 4 and 8 pages in length. You may use any fontyour like (e.g. Times New Roman, Ariel, Cambria, etc.), but the paper must be written in 12-pointfont, double-spaced, with 1 inch margins, and of at least 4 full pages of writing (not including references or titles/headings). Cite at least 3 academic sources in your paper.

– Paper should include the following sections (clearly labeled):

1. An Introduction in which you briefly discuss what you see as your major findings. The

introduction should include a brief description of the policy or profession and also clearly

depict the focus of your paper. Your introduction must firmly situate the topic of your paper in

the literature – discuss what prior research has shown about this particular aspect of aging or

highlight the patterns of historical change in addressing aging.

2. Analysis will form the majority of the paper. It is critical that you link your discussion to

concepts, theories, and issues. Describe the policy, the issues it was designed to

address, the population it serves, its impact on our society, and any intergenerational concerns

or critiques it has raised.

3. The Conclusion should briefly summarize your understanding of the policy and the main points of your paper. It should also reflect on how your paper broadly

and discuss how your points either supported or

contradicted findings of prior research or demonstrated historical change.

4. A references page must list the sources cited throughout the paper in either APA or ASA format.

Although you may choose which style to use, you must consistently and correctly format the

citations and references throughout your paper.
